Tragedy marked with irony is a staple in the dark comedy genre, and The Marriage of Bette and Boo tickets provide theater-goers another way to experience in this group. The story is narrated by Bette and Boo's son, Matt. He takes the audience through a journey from his parents' wedding for their solution more than 20 years later. Boo is a drunk and Bette are neurotic woman who has had other destructive stillbirths.

No better is the rest of Matt's family. His grandparents on his father's side include a man who is completely absorbed in work, and hates his wife. His mother's sister is certifiably insane. The town priest can not even inject hope into his congregants and look more like salt in the wound than a band-aid. Matt brings in its take on many of the events and shows how a young man can marry live in such an environment. The subject matter may seem depressing, but the rapid development, 33-scene show adds ironic and funny comments to keep the plot seems surprisingly light and do Marriage of Bette and Boo tickets worth a night out.

The idea written by playwright Christopher Durang achieved. He has a large amount of both plays and musicals, including History of the American Film, Sister Mary Ignatius Explains It All For You, Baby with the bathwater and Laughing Wild. He has acted in a few of his productions as well as others and has worked with stars like Sigourney Weaver and Julie Andrews. He has also appeared in films such as The Secret of My Success, The Butcher's Wife and Housesitter.

Kate Jennings Grant plays Bette and has been on Broadway in Poof and An American Daughter, as well as Off-Broadway productions such as Radiant Baby and Summer of '42. She has been on TV in shows like Cold Case and Law & Order and movies like United 93 and When a Stranger Calls. Christopher Evan Welch thinks about the role of Boo and has appeared in shows like Romeo and Juliet, The Crucible and Much Ado About Nothing, and been on TV and in movies like The Stepford Wives. Charles Socarides plays their son Matt, and his credits include the missing person, old money and Indian blood. Other members of the cast includes Heather Burns, Victoria Clark and Adam Lefevre.
